Output 690b527e56315501d56663818042f04b968c0d789606f2f3e3dcdd77ea306b16:0

value
59598119
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d05b33c0f20e1e96f647c13f580e535e00272ca8 OP_EQUAL
address
MStr3AiMmN9VYPwvaFCSijxqvXvphamQZ2
transaction
690b527e56315501d56663818042f04b968c0d789606f2f3e3dcdd77ea306b16
spent
true